- Choose a secluded spot: Find a spot at least 200 feet away from water sources, trails, and campsites to minimize the impact on the environment.
- Dig a cathole: If you're in a wooded area, dig a small hole (6-8 inches deep) for your, ahem, deposit. This helps prevent the spread of disease and keeps the area clean.
- Pack it out: If you're in an area without catholes or prefer not to dig, consider packing out your waste with a portable toilet or a specialized bag.
- Dispose of waste properly: When you return to civilization, dispose of your waste in a toilet and wash your hands thoroughly.
